About this Role

This is an exciting opportunity to join Dawsongroup Temperature Control Solutions (DGTCS), where you'll build commercial experience, develop customer relationships and follow a structured pathway towards becoming a Business Development Manager. Generate new business opportunities through customer visits, networking and proactive business development across your North East territory. Build strong relationships with new and existing customers, identifying opportunities to grow hire revenue and deliver excellent customer experiences. Prepare quotations and commercial proposals, working closely with our Service and Projects teams to deliver the right solution for every customer. Manage your sales pipeline using our CRM, keeping customer information accurate while identifying future opportunities. Promote the wider Dawsongroup offering, introducing customers to additional Business Units whenever appropriate.

About Us

Dawsongroup Temperature Control Solutions is part of Dawsongroup, a business with over 90 years of heritage and more than 50 years of experience in asset rental. Operating with the values that shaped us as a family business, and now under the ownership of KKR, we continue to help customers build smarter, more resilient operations. 24 days standard leave allowance + Birthday + Bank Holidays + up to 10 days extra (time served and purchase scheme). 2x Life Assurance scheme.
